Resumen del Editor

It's 1944, and World War II is raging through Europe. Lieutenant Bradford Reimer, forced to leave his wife and ill daughter in Pennsylvania, finds himself fighting for his life and the lives of his men in the Battle of the Bulge. As they escape certain death, they end up in the Belgian Village of Ciel, where they meet a kindly old man named Nikolaas.

The war seems not to have touched this village, but Reimer and his men soon learn that there is more to the old man and the village that meets the eye, and each of them begin to learn something about who they truly are. Reimer, too, learns that his lost faith, and the meaning of Christmas, is not lost forever, but he merely needs to be shown the way through the fog of war and his rage.

Edge of your seat and emotional story

Bradford Reimer loathes Christmas and all it stands for; he has lost his faith. Forced to leave his ill daughter and wife behind as he goes to fight in WWII, it is here amidst the death and violence that Reimer begins to understand faith. Pushed beyond his limits, Reimer is reminded that he is not alone. Aided by a grandfatherly village man along with his granddaughter, Reimer begins to find his faith. However, it is not until he returns home that he discovers the full extent of the power of faith and the mysterious power faith holds. This story also has a supernatural/paranormal feel to it at times.

I despise crying and this book made me cry! The author, Harry Karapalides, builds a strong story of faith and redemption. The listener cannot help but be drawn into the story and feel the pain and confusion, love, and fears that Reimer carries with each step. Karapalides carefully built each character to reinforce the power of faith and redemption. This is a powerful story that will have you, the listener, looking more closely at your life, passion, love, and faith.

The narrator, David Scott Jarvis, provides each character with a unique voice and captures the personality and presence of each character expertly. How he kept from crying is beyond me! I liked his pace, he spoke methodically, clearly, and with a rich voice. Between the author and narrator, this was a nail-biting story.

This is one of those stories that tug at your heartstrings and beliefs with a twinge or two of the supernatural. This was a good book that holds your attention in a variety of ways, I look forward to more by Karapalides!
